Bad Royale is a 4 headed beast of a DJ and production team who have just released the first single “Bun It Up” feat. Bunji Garlin to their anticipated EP, Immutable Timeline, out May 6th via Diplo’s Mad Decent. The track is a Serato scorcher for the summer and a sure-fire party starter as soon as the beat drops.

Check out what Bad Royale had to say about the track to Billboard below.

Working with Bunji has been amazing. It’s incredible to see how fast he is and just freestyling lyrics on the spot. ‘Bun It Up’ was actually the first ever accapella he did for us and we’ve been sitting on it until we finally had a track built around it that felt perfect. We really wanted to take it back a little bit and make a track that felt more upbeat and fun and we think we really nailed it.

Time-traveling-turnt-team Bad Royale matures their sound on the Immutable Timeline EP, their second EP on Mad Decent.

Starting things off of the right foot, “The Royale Anthem” and “Dutty Heart” featuring Richie Loopand IAmStylezMusic respectively, kick off the release with familiar but fresh vibes – like coming home to your pet iguana in a new parka and shoes.

To follow that up, we hear Konshens and the guys linking up for “All We Need Is Love,” a pop record guaranteed to make you fall in love in the club. “Bun It Up” jumps into the full-out party side of things with Bunji Garlin. Bunji Garlin complements the track to create a finished product worthy of any set.

Finally, “Suit of Black” featuring Suit Of Black – the Caribbean dream team comprised of Kardinal Offishall, Bunji Garlin and Assassin aka Agent Sasco – is a straight up dancehall hitter that perfectly closes out this beautiful gauntlet of an EP.
